Jamiroquai are an English funk and acid jazz band formed and fronted by Jay Kay (born Dec 30 as Jason Kay). The group consisted of Derrick McKenzie on drums, Toby Smith on a keyboard, Stuart Zender on bass, Wallis Buchanan on vibraphone and Simon Katz on guitar. Jamiroquai is named after an Iroquois native American tribe. They are best known for songs/videos like "Virtual Insanity", "Cosmic Girl" and UK chartopper "Deeper Underground". Their debut album "Emergency on the planet earth" went #1 on UK album chart and spawned several singles including the Top 10 hit, "Too young to die". Their second album "Return of the Space Cowboy" was just as successful with another top 10 single, "Stillness in time" and a US Dance #1 in 1995. Their third album "Travelling Without Moving" spawned arguably their biggest singles "Virtual Insanity", "Cosmic Girl" and "Alright". They had UK#1 single "Deeper underground" from the Roland Emmerich film, "Godzilla" in 1998. Another #1 album "Synkronized" spawned US Dance #1 hit "Canned heat".

What happened next?
Jamiroquai had another #1 album in "A Funk Odyssey" and few more hit singles in "Little L" (UK#5 in 2001) and "Feels Just Like It Should" (UK#8 in 2005).
